Hi Pilots!

I want to get video from pilots to use in my movies. I have not had much success in the past. There are some problems:

  1. How to get the videos. My foil hat level requirements for security and privacy prevent me from using most places where pilots share video.
  2. How to inform the pilots that I want video, what I need, what I will use for.

Problem A: I will provide an upload link that pilots can use to send videos to my cloud storage.

Problem B: I'm considering making cards, business card size, to distribute with basic information that I want videos and this link https://www.splododyne.com/index.php/pilots for more information.

Handing out the cards or putting them on a table at the LZ seems pushy or like some sleazy sales thing. But I don't get video if pilots don't know that I want it.

Please give your opinions, suggestions, or advice on this method or alternatives.

Finis wrote:My gliding movies are here now: https://rumble.com/playlists/SvI4WGJw7dg


Thanks for the update. Do you know if Rumble has a way to embed videos in other web sites?

For example, the following code will embed a YouTube video:

    <iframe width="560" height="315" src="https://www.youtube.com/embed/ESuwxdlpmhI" frameborder="0" allowfullscreen></iframe>



I've implemented that code with the "[youtube]" tag here on U.S. Hawks.

Vimeo uses similar code:

    <iframe title="vimeo-player" src="https://player.vimeo.com/video/338775551" width="640" height="360" frameborder="0" allowfullscreen></iframe>



That's similarly implemented with the "[vimeo]" tag here on U.S. Hawks.

Do you know the proper way to embed videos from Rumble?

Thanks in advance.
